Abstract
To optimize energy consumption in wireless sensor networks (WSNs) and prolong life cycle of networks, aiming at the problems in LEACH algorithm, such as random selection of cluster-heads, indeterminate cluster-heads number, accelerated death of cluster-head nodes and so on, an efficient clustering routing algorithm for WSNs (EECR) was proposed. This algorithm is based on LEACH algorithm. In the cluster building stage, four sub-thresholds were designed, i.e. residual energy of node, based on base-station distance, number of cluster-head in networks and round number that nodes are selected as cluster-heads. In stable data transmission stage, the effective path of node was utilized and free spatial model and multi-path attenuation model were integrated to realize effective data transmission. In simulation experiment, the network life, residual energy and information amount received by base station were compared. The results indicate that, compared to LEACH, LEACH-C, HEED and EEUC, the EECR algorithm can effectively reduce energy consumption and prolong network lifetime, and its overall performance is superior to LEACH, LEACH-C, HEED and EEUC algorithms.
Get full access to this article
View all access options for this article.
